You are welcome Noblekids. Our prayer is that God'll answer you speedily in Jesus' Name.

Sorry about your sister. There's always a reason to hope as long as there is life.

About your husband's sfa, is there any infection? If there is, please treat it with doctor-prescribed medication.

Then try placing him on a fertility supplement like Fertilsan M, a supplement for improving sperm health. It has one of the highest reviews at the moment. Other supplements are Wellman Conception, high dose vit. C, vit. E, etc.

Other home remedies include:

Dietary changes. Stop artificial sugar completely and replace with honey. You may blend honey and onions together to increase his sex drive;
a blend of tiger nuts, coconut and dates; fruits, vegetables,green smoothies; milk; pap; proteinous diet like eggs, beans.

Bitters: like ruzu bitters, yoyo bitters or simply bitter kola as highly recommended by my darling forevergirl.

No alcohol, no smoking.

He should wear loose boxers and try to sleep naked as often as possible to reduce heat. Heat kills sperm. So the idea is to keep the body cool.

He shouldn't abstain for too long, and should try to have sex at least once before your fertile window. And have sex more often around your fertile window.

Try the doggy style to deposit the sperm as close to the cervix as possible.
